在近期举行的EclipseCon大会上,微软宣布加入Eclipse基金会。这是微软近期的各种开源动向中的又一个重大举动。
在Java的技术圈中,Eclipse可谓是无人不知无人不晓,基本上10个Java开发,有9个都在用Eclipse作为自己的IDE。其实,微软和Eclipse基金会的合作早就已经开始,比如:Azure Toolkit for Eclipse, Java SDK for Azure, Team Explorer Everywhere这些产品均可以在Eclipse的插件市场获取。
在这次的EclipseCon大会keynote上, Tyler Jewell宣布了全新的Eclipse Che 4.0发布,并和微软一起宣布了这一版本对于Azure和Visual Studio Team Service的支持。Eclipse Che是全新一代的开发平台,包括了
– 工作区协作服务:可以让开发人员通过这个服务共享工作区。
– 云中的IDE:全部通过浏览器使用的WebIDE
– 插件框架:允许开发人员使用插件扩展Che的功能
– 技术栈:可使用任何开发语言或者框架来创建项目,从Che的镜像库,DockerHub或者其他镜像中获取框架并生成dockerfile
点击以下链接观看keynote:
http://www.infoq.com/presentations/eclipse-che-eclipsecon-2016
另外,微软也在这次大会上宣布了Team Explorer Everywhere (TEE)正式开源,并通过github提供源代码和接受社区的pull request。TEE是微软提供的Eclipse插件,可以允许开发人员通过eclipse访问基于Visual Studio Team Service的开发管理平台,其中提供了应用全生命周期管理能力,包括:需求,规划,任务,源代码(GIT),持续集成,自动化测试和自动发布等功能。
TEE github 地址:
https://github.com/Microsoft/team-explorer-everywhere
Visual Studio Team Services:
https://www.visualstudio.com/products/visual-studio-team-services-vs
微软近期的一系列举动越来越受到开源社区的欢迎与关注,这次和Eclipse基金会的正式合作应该可以帮助广大Java开发者对微软这位另类朋友有更多一些认识。
请关注微信公众号 【devopshub】,获取更多关于DevOps研发运维一体化的信息